Tips For Reducing Damages In Line Pipe Hauling

By Ryan Olson


When you are in a business that involves transportation and delivery of goods, one of the challenges to expect is the safety and security of all the goods in transit. If these products get stolen or damaged, your business will record a reduction in profits and even losses sometimes. The following points will help you enhance the safety of goods in line pipe hauling.

For transport to take place, vehicles must be present. Whether you are hiring these vehicles or you are using your own, it is good to emphasize on quality. Different brands offer different qualities, and you ought to know the most reputable brand that has lower risks of breaking down. You do not want your driver to be stuck in the middle of an insecure desert while transporting the load.

Your client will feel that you are competent if he too can trace the movement of the vehicle transporting his order. You also need to be aware of the actions of the driver and detect situations where he might need help either for security reasons or a vehicle breakdown. This is why you need to invest in suitable tracking devices. Look for a firm that will install the tools and train you on how to operate them.

Professionals must be hired in the company too if you want to avoid a lot of damages. This ranges from the drivers to the engineers that handle the machines in the company. An inexperienced driver is likely to get involved in an accident that will damage the goods. He may also sustain serious injuries from the accident, and this will affect the operations of a company.

The equipment used to handle these goods should have unique features that prevent harm to the products. Before setting up your business, you should research to know the kind of machines to use and the features that each one of them should have. You can always seek the help of an expert or more experienced entrepreneurs.

The inspection of vehicles and other equipment in your company will also help in avoiding losses. When you have engineers checking the condition of your machines regularly, adverse effects are avoided as possible faults are detected and rectified early enough. This also protects the employees that would have been injured by the machines during the breakdown. Record of all the inspections should be well kept.

You need to hire supervisors in your plant too. Even the best professionals make mistakes, and it is good to have someone checking on the progress all the time. Supervisors should be people that have been in this field for quite an extended period. They can quickly detect when the items are being handled in the wrong manner and make changes before the damage is done.

Ensure the activities of the company are maintained at the capacity it has. This means that the workers should not be overworked as they may fail to pay attention to the safety measures. The machines and vehicles should also not be allowed to handle loads above what the manufacturers recommend. This prevents a lot of breakdowns and accidents; hence, the company will not count losses later on.
